Example 3

The satellite runs along a round orbit with a rotational period of T = 88 min. What is its linear velocity v, since we know that its orbit is located at a distance of h= 200 km from the Earth's surface?

Example 7

An alternating current circuit with a voltage of 220 V and a frequency of 50 Hz connected to capacitor 35.4 mcF, active resistance 100 Ohm, and the induction coefficient L = 0.7 H. Find the circuit current amplitude and the drop of voltage in the capacitor, ohmic resistance, and inductance.

Example 8

Probability of non-standard spare part manufacture is 0.11. Using the Bernoulli formula, find the probability of the fact that if we take five manufactured spare parts, four of them will be standard.
